Maternal Age and Contractility of Human Myometrium in Pregnancy.

Abstract

There is controversy as to whether maternal age exerts an influence on the contractility of human myometrium in pregnancy. The aim of this study was to examine a series of functional contractile parameters of human myometrium in vitro, over a broad range of maternal ages. Myometrial tissue specimens were obtained at cesarean delivery from 32 women with maternal ages ranging from 28 to 52 years. Using in vitro recordings, a number of contractile parameters including maximal amplitude, mean contractile force, time to maximal amplitude, maximum rate of rise, and occurrence of simple and complex (biphasic and multiphasic) contractions were examined for spontaneous and induced contractile activity. The relationship between maternal age and individual parameters was evaluated using linear regression analysis. For all contractile parameters examined, for both spontaneous and induced contractions, no significant correlation was observed with maternal age between 28 and 52 years. The mean maximum amplitude values for spontaneous and oxytocin-induced contractions were 23 ± 3 and 43 ± 5 mN, respectively. The mean contractile forces for spontaneous and oxytocin-induced contractions were 1.5 ± 0.2 and 6.5 ± 0.9 mN, respectively. There was no variation in the proportion of biphasic or multiphasic contractions with maternal age. These results indicate there is no significant functional impairment of uterine contractility and no lack in responsiveness of myometrium in vitro, in the older mother. These findings do not support the concept that there may be a biological basis for dysfunctional labor or increased cesarean delivery rates in older parturients.

关于孕期母亲年龄是否会对人类子宫肌层的收缩性产生影响,目前存在争议。本研究的目的是在较宽的母亲年龄范围内,体外检测人类子宫肌层的一系列功能收缩参数。在剖宫产时从32名母亲年龄在28至52岁之间的女性获取子宫肌层组织标本。通过体外记录,检测了包括最大振幅、平均收缩力、达到最大振幅的时间、最大上升速率以及单收缩和复合收缩(双相和多相)的发生率等多个收缩参数的自发和诱发收缩活动。使用线性回归分析评估母亲年龄与各个参数之间的关系。对于所检测的所有收缩参数,无论是自发收缩还是诱发收缩,在28至52岁的母亲年龄之间均未观察到与母亲年龄有显著相关性。自发收缩和催产素诱发收缩的平均最大振幅值分别为23±3和43±5 mN。自发收缩和催产素诱发收缩的平均收缩力分别为1.5±0.2和6.5±0.9 mN。双相或多相收缩的比例在不同母亲年龄之间没有变化。这些结果表明,在年龄较大的母亲中,子宫收缩性没有明显的功能损害,子宫肌层在体外也不存在反应性不足。这些发现不支持这样的观点,即高龄产妇分娩功能障碍或剖宫产率增加可能存在生物学基础。
